猿代码 — 科研/AI模型/高性能计算
0

HPC环境配置与性能优化实战指南

摘要: HPC环境配置与性能优化实战指南HPC(High Performance Computing)是高性能计算的缩写,是一种强大的计算技术,可以通过并行处理大规模数据和复杂计算任务。HPC系统通常由大量处理器、存储设备和网络组成,能够提供 ...
HPC环境配置与性能优化实战指南

HPC(High Performance Computing)是高性能计算的缩写,是一种强大的计算技术,可以通过并行处理大规模数据和复杂计算任务。HPC系统通常由大量处理器、存储设备和网络组成,能够提供比普通计算机更高的性能和处理能力。

在实际应用中,要充分发挥HPC系统的性能,就需要进行合理的环境配置和性能优化。本文将针对HPC环境配置与性能优化进行实战指南,帮助读者更好地理解和应用HPC技术。

首先,了解HPC系统的硬件架构是非常重要的。HPC系统通常包括计算节点、存储节点、管理节点和网络设备等组成部分。每个部分的性能和负载都会对整个系统的性能产生影响,因此需要对每个部分进行仔细的配置和调优。

其次,对于HPC系统的软件环境也需要进行合理的配置。HPC系统通常会运行高性能计算应用程序,这些应用程序对于系统的软件环境有着相当高的要求。因此,在配置软件环境时,需要选择合适的操作系统、文件系统、编程语言和并行计算库等组件,以确保系统能够高效地运行各种类型的应用程序。

在进行HPC系统的环境配置时,还需要考虑到系统的安全性和可靠性。由于HPC系统通常会处理大量敏感数据和重要计算任务,因此系统的安全性和可靠性是非常重要的。在环境配置过程中,需要对系统进行安全加固和备份配置,以确保系统不会受到恶意攻击或数据丢失的影响。

除了环境配置外,性能优化也是HPC系统中的重要工作之一。性能优化旨在提高系统的计算能力和数据处理速度,从而能够更快地完成各种计算任务。在性能优化过程中,需要对系统的硬件和软件进行全面的分析,找出系统性能瓶颈,并针对性地进行调优。

在HPC系统的性能优化过程中,并行计算是一个非常重要的技术。由于HPC系统通常拥有大量的处理器和内存,因此能够运行并行计算任务。通过合理地划分数据和任务,并采用并行算法和编程模型,可以显著提高系统的计算能力和效率。

此外,针对特定的应用场景进行定制化的性能优化也是非常重要的。由于不同的应用程序具有不同的特点和需求,因此需要针对具体的应用场景进行性能优化。在性能优化过程中,需要深入理解应用程序的计算特点和数据处理需求,从而能够找到最优的优化策略。

总之,HPC环境配置与性能优化是HPC系统中的重要工作,对于提高系统的计算能力和处理效率具有非常重要的意义。通过合理地配置系统环境和进行针对性的性能优化,可以使HPC系统更好地满足各种计算需求,为科学研究和工程计算提供更强大的支持。希望本文的实战指南能够帮助读者更好地理解和应用HPC环境配置与性能优化技术。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-5 19:39
  • 0
    粉丝
  • 86
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)